Overview
Infinity Train is an exciting animated series created by Owen Dennis. ๐ŸŽจ

The show first aired on Cartoon Network in 2019 and ran for four seasons. It took place on a mysterious train that travels through strange and wonderful worlds. Each season features a different main character who boards the train to solve their personal problems. The train has countless cars, each with unique adventures! ๐ŸŒˆ

The show is known for its epic storytelling, emotional moments, and cool visuals. It encourages kids to think about their feelings and understand others.

Plot Summary
In Infinity Train, characters find themselves on a magical train that never stops! ๐Ÿš‚

Each car on the train holds different challenges and lessons. The first season follows a girl named Tulip who wants to get home. As she travels the train, she meets friends like One-One and Atticus, a brave dog. ๐Ÿถ

Together, they face puzzles, odd creatures, and their own emotions. In later seasons, other characters, like Grace and Simon, join the adventure, facing their own problems and learning important life lessons. The train is a metaphor for personal growth! ๐ŸŒŸ

Animation Style
Infinity Train is known for its unique animation style! ๐ŸŽจ

The characters have distinct designs, with Tulip's vibrant red hair standing out. The backgrounds are colorful and creative, often changing to match the theme of each train car. The animation uses smooth movements and expressive facial features to convey emotions. ๐ŸŒˆ

It combines 2D and 3D elements to create an immersive world. The artistry helps tell the story in a fun and captivating way, making every episode a visual treat for the audience! ๐ŸŽฅ

Themes and Symbols
Infinity Train explores very important themes! ๐ŸŒŸ

One big theme is personal growthโ€”each character has to face their fears and feelings. The train itself symbolizes life's journey and the ups and downs we go through. ๐Ÿš†

The various train cars represent different challenges and experiences. Another theme is friendship, showing how working together can help us solve problems. The tapestry of memories is a symbol of our past experiences that shape who we are. Overall, it teaches empathy and understanding of oneself and others.
